ALEX
CASTELLANOS replies:
I
think if you get a less negative message, in many cases, in this country
you get a less factual message. The truest spots, most factual spots,
are the negative and comparative. They inform the voters much more than
a bunch of fluffy positives often do.
Secondly, are you sure we don't need more negative messages? Our government's
broken. You know, we've spent a zillion dollars trying to fix these problems
in America all of which are worse. And, basically Washington is very ineffective.
Don't we need to compel change? Maybe we need more negative commercials,
not less?
